Default A sneak peek on "Joher Speaks..."

Much to my surprise, Joher called me again last night. I have little time to talk, but let me say that Joher is a storyteller and I enjoyed listening to what he had to say. (We spoke for about an hour and a half).

I got him to answer some of the ?s, so here's a preview...

He mentioned his favorite people to work with on the set. (He didn't mention the whole cast, just 4 in detail he really loved to work with.)

In regards to what he did to try to alleviate the sitch as to his little screen time on the set, he said he wrote a script he wanted them to use where Jawaharlal has this crush on Maria (they didn't use that)...and IRL, he had a mad crush on Leslie. "Who wouldn't?" He said. "She's hot. She's a beautiful, all-american girl." I replied with "I KNEW IT!" Remember earlier in these boards where I mentioned my suspicions to that? I was right. They happened to be near each other in many scenes. (He didn't really give a clear answer as to whether she liked him back like that.)

Mentioned his name change.

He's going to e-mail me with more answers to the ?s.

The embarrassing thing is, he saw "The Story on Jory" for the first time last night...while we were on the phone! Of course, I was turning red with embarrassment. "Come on," he said. "You obviously have a reason for contacting me and asking me all these questions...don't be embarrassed!" (Read where I thought the mini-mart guy he played in "Earth Girls Are Easy" was stereotyped, and told me to "rewatch it, and see that he really wasn't at all.")

Let me tell you all, Joher is nothing like Jawaharlal. He's loud, goofy, boisterous, and a lot more outgoing than Jawaharlal....in a good way.

Actually, his name of birth is Johar (I cannot spell it phonetically to save my life...it sounded like he pronounced it J'wahr or something like that). He talked about how no one he knew could pronounce it properly..."people would pronounce it like 'Jo-hair', like the hair on someone's head!", so he changed it to the more pronounceable "Joher," which is a Persian version of his father's name.
